Can you flash your gun if threatened in the car?

I'm in Georgia, so it is legal to carry a firearm in your car. If someone with road rage jumped out of their car and started yelling at you through your window could you threaten them with the gun? Or just flash the gun and not point it?

You can't draw a weapon without intent to use it. That's what they teach in concealed carry classes. If you draw your gun, someone had better be shot. Otherwise, you're in trouble.

There is a rule of thumb EVERYONE should follow when using a firearm. NEVER EVER BRANDISH A FIREARM IF YOU DO NOT INTEND TO USE IT. DON'T EVEN THINK ABOUT IT. It is stupid, a legal mess, and can get you shot very very quickly. Just don't do it unless you are ready to maim or kill.
